IMPORTANT INFORMATION ON IDROMED® 5 GS 1.1. SAFETY INFORMATION Symbol for important safety instructions. Please follow these instructions carefully to prevent health risks and damage to property. ® In case of the following conditions the idromed 5 should not be used or should only be used after consulting your doctor: cardiac arrhythmia electronically controlled implanted devices (e.g. pacemaker) metallic implanted devices in the area where the current flows metallic intrauterine implanted devices (loop) pregnancy bigger skin diseases insensitivity to pain Prolonged usage of high frequency surgery units on a patient can cause burns under electrodes. Application of the electrodes close to the ribcage can increase the risk of ventricular fibrillation. Effective current densities over 2 mA/cm² at all electrode faces require higher attention from the user. During treatment the electric circuit needs to be completed constantly . i.e. maintain at least one hand or foot in each tub. Conductive material (e.g. metal, water pipes etc.) must not be touched during treatment. All jewellery on hands and feet must be removed before starting treatment. Any damage to skin (minor injuries, scratches etc.) on the palms of the hands, soles of the feet, cuticles or at the armpits must be coated with vaseline or a fatty cream before treatment, as current permeability will be higher than normal on those spots. Please do only cover these spots! Current intensity is set according to individual requirements of the user. The ideal current intensity evokes a pleasant, tingling sensation (not on the treatment of the armpits). The values listed in these instructions are the maximum values allowed. Current intensity chosen by the user, however, should normally be much lower, otherwise there is a danger of burning the skin (e.g. the usual range for the treatment of the armpits is about 1 – 2 mA). Moisten the sponges from inside and outside, until they don’t drip (do not wring them out) If the sponges are too dry, there is a danger of burns Attention, there is a danger of burns, when the metallic electrodes are in direct contact with the skin. When treating armpits, the sponge electrodes have to be kept still and with constant pressure under the armpits, otherwise fluctuations of current will occur on the display of the unit. Never short-circuit the metallic electrodes. 3 idromed® 5 GS Dr. K. TREATMENT If possible, treatment should be performed once a day initially. Treatment should last 10-15 minutes, depending on the doctor’s prescription. Normally, after 10 - 15 treatments, a normal hydrosis level is reached and the skin moisture is normalized. The intervals of treatment should now be extended gradually. (1st week - every 2 days, 2nd week - every 3 days, until there is just one treatment per week) The inhibition of sweating is much more pronounced at the plus pole than at the minus pole. In order to optimize the therapeutic effect, you should therefore switch polarities before every th 5 treatment session. To do this, all you have to do is swap the electrode leads. The maximum values permissible are: • For the treatment of the hands: 15 mA • For the treatment of the feet or of hands and feet: 25 mA • For the treatment of the armpits: 5 mA If the current intensity selected is too high, you may experience an unpleasant tingling sensation in the extremities treated during the session. If this occurs, a lower current intensity has to be selected otherwise there is a danger of burns. 2.4.1. TREATMENT OF HYPERHIDROSIS AT THE ARMPITS Before the treatment clean the armpits with clear water, in order to remove any cosmetics and so to avoid any irritation of the skin. For treatment of the armpits use the 2 optional sponge electrodes with the sponges: optional accessory armpit electrodes with sponges (art.-no. 995100) Do not switch off the unit during treatment. Moisten the sponges together with the electrodes in a water bath for about 30 seconds. Press the water from the sponges until they do not drip (do not wring them out). The more water remains in the sponges, the better the current will be directed to the areas which have to be treated. There is a danger of burns, if the sponges are too dry. Attention, there is a danger of burns, if the metallic electrodes are in direct contact with the skin. Use the 2 electrode cables to connect the electrodes with the positive and the negative pole of the unit. Switch on the unit by pushing down the turning knob. IMPORTANT TIPS AND INFORMATION • To simplify therapy the current intensity in mA for your treatment (pleasant tingling sensation – aside from the treatment of the armpits) is displayed and can be set again consistently. • The maximum current and voltage are limited by safety limits prescribed for electrical medical equipment. Nevertheless, do not remove your hand and/or feet from treatment tubs during the session (keep the current circuit closed). Take care, that the unit is not switched off during treatment. • The inhibition of sweating is much more pronounced at the positive pole than at the negative pole. In order to optimize the therapeutic effect, you should therefore switch polarities before th every 5 treatment session. To do this, you have only to swap the electrode leads. • Please take care, that the water you are using is normal tap water and has not been treated with a water softener before. That reduces the conductibility of water and treatment can be make only conditional or none. 9 idromed® 5 GS Dr. K. Hönle Medizintechnik GmbH OPERATING INSTRUCTIONS 4.
